MySQL中处理大型字符串的技术(mysql大字符串类型)

MySQL是一款相当受欢迎的关系型数据库,它具有良好的性能。然而,当它处理大型字符串时,可能会遇到一些挑战。因此,了解MySQL中处理大型字符串的技术有助于提高数据库性能及维护高可用性。

其中一种常见的技术是使用VARCHAR数据类型。VARCHAR数据类型允许存储非固定长度的字符串,它使用一定数量的字节来存储字符串,可以根据实际大小来调整存储数量,因此有助于减少存储开销。

另一种技术是INNODB存储引擎,因为它提供了最大程度的性能,在处理大型字符串时,性能有了明显的改善。INNODB存储引擎有很多特点,可以支持大内存操作,确保大型字符串分配有效的空间,允许跨表的大内存操作,提供数据的并发性,等等。

此外,MySQL中还有TEXT类型,它用于存储大量文本数据,因此可以有效地处理大型字符串。TEXT类型也可以用作动态链接库中自定义数据类型,可以加快数据库处理速度和提高存储容量。

最后,MySQL中还有一种处理大型字符串的技术,称为分组文本(GROUP_CONCAT)函数。该函数能够将多个文本字符串拼接起来,从而更加方便地处理大型字符串。该函数也可以在查询中用于聚合多个文本字段,从而使数据库查询变得容易。

总而言之,MySQL中有许多不同的技术可以处理大型字符串,如VARCHAR数据类型、INNODB存储引擎和TEXT类型以及GROUP_CONCAT函数等。这些技术有助于提高MySQL处理大型字符串的性能以及减少存储开销。


数据运维技术 » MySQL中处理大型字符串的技术(mysql大字符串类型)